Output 33bcef6a93e588f675eb7493f8aa624b316ea4daab7f6b9dde396e4b03b33461:1

value
20538827
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ec4eb726baef38d2e6fafdfdef40d352d67be547f456aa948e3678ade2b1a0b
address
tb1pdmzwkunt4mec6tn04l0aaaqdx5kk00j50azk422gudnc4h3trg9sue2m0c
transaction
33bcef6a93e588f675eb7493f8aa624b316ea4daab7f6b9dde396e4b03b33461
spent
true